认知误区:助记词就是万能钥匙?

在区块链世界中,助记词(Mnemonic Phrase)被视为用户获取和恢复钱包的“万能钥匙”。很多人认为,只要手中有助记词,随时随地就能恢复钱包。然而,当导入助记词失败时,两旁的“技术巨人”便被这道晴天霹雳迎头击倒:你知道吗,实际上助记词的储存和导入过程中,存在诸多隐秘的安全环节?

一旦助记词导入失败,意味着你的资产可能处于“无限悬挂”状态,尤其是当你在手机、电脑、硬件钱包之间进行转移时,更是让人心急如焚。加密钱包虽然为我们提供了便捷,但其内在的脆弱性却可能让人措手不及。旦这种失败降临,你是否会因为对助记词的误解而将自己“锁”在了钱包外?

安全原理:助记词背后的技术链条

为了解决助记词导入失败的问题,首先我们需了解助记词的生成及导入原理。助记词基于一套称为 BIP39 的标准,该标准规定了如何将随机生成的种子用一组易记的单词表示。相对来说,这一过程并不复杂,但当我们深入挖掘时,却能发现不少风险。

首先,TRNG(真随机数生成)与 PRNG(伪随机数生成)之间的区别至关重要。对于助记词的生成,真随机数生成器通过物理事件(如电子噪声)创建完全不可预测的数,而伪随机数生成器则依赖算法生成可预测的数列。如果钱包软件使用的是PRNG,攻击者只需获取足够的信息便可能重现这一伪随机序列,从而影响助记词的安全性。

其次,安全芯片和固件的防篡改性也不容忽视。许多硬件钱包使用专用的安全芯片(如TPM)来确保私钥和助记词不被恶意软件窃取。然而,芯片如果未做严格的固件验证,将面临固件漏洞的风险,甚至可以遭受针对性攻击。2019年的一个案例中,一款知名硬件钱包因固件漏洞造成用户资产损失,使人们意识到硬件的“物理安全”绝非终极保障。

风险拆解:助记词导入失败的真相

除了上述安全原理,还有几种常见的助记词导入失败原因:

1. 助记词长度错误:助记词的长度要符合12、15、18、21或24个单词的标准。很多用户可能错误理解为输入的单词越多越安全,导致输入不规范而无法识别。

2. 单词拼写或顺序错误:即使是微小的拼写错误,如“dog”与“log”之类的真相,都会导致钱包无法识别你的助记词。

3. 不同钱包间兼容性不同厂商的加密钱包可能采用不同的实现标准。例如,某些钱包可能支持BIP39,但并不完全兼容BIP32或BIP44,造成导入失败。

实操建议:确保助记词安全与恢复

基于以上对助记词导入失败的风险分析,以下是几条具体的防范建议,保障你的比特币钱包安全:

1. 验证助记词的正确性:在导入之前,确保助记词的拼写和顺序完全正确。再三确认单词的拼写,必要时保留一个副本。通过外部工具验证助记词生成的私钥,这能确保其真实有效。

2. 使用经过审计的钱包软件:选择经过第三方审计的钱包,确保其在处理助记词时遵循最佳实践。这可以减少由于软件缺陷导致的风险。官方平台的更新也需要定期关注,以确保安全性。

3. 硬件钱包的选择和使用:选择具有TPM或其他硬件安全模块的钱包。当你在安装或更新固件时,一定要确保官方来源,以避免篡改风险带来的巨大损失。

4. 制定定期备份计划:定期对助记词和私钥进行备份,并在安全的离线环境中存储。同时,避免在不可信终端进行恢复操作,以防止硬件或软件的恶意篡改。

自我检查:你现在就能看看自己的设置

所有这些安全建议听上去似乎不那么复杂,但在实际操作中,很多用户往往会忽视细节。你是否已经认真检查自己的助记词是否完好?你的钱包软件是否是最新版本?在下次你进行任何形式的导入恢复时,不妨再次仔细检查,避免让人感到不安的错误再次发生。

相互分享你的经验和教训,或许可以帮助到更多人在安全的路上少走弯路。